Abstract
Annie Claustres presents material culture. She presents its current relationship to art, craft and design through different dimensions of analysis such as anthropology and art history.
Article
Annie Claustres is an HDR lecturer in contemporary art history and theory at Université Lyon 2, and recently published Objets emblèmes, objets du don. Enjeux postmodernes de la culture matérielle, de 1964 à nos jours [Presses du réel, 2017], which analyzes the interactions between everyday object art and design in terms of material culture, and updates theories of the gift. She is a laureate of the Villa Kujoyama 2019.
